随着科技的不断进步,人工智能(AI)已经渗透到我们生活的方方面面。在空间探索领域,AI技术的应用正引发一场革命,为人类探索宇宙的旅程带来前所未有的变化。本文将深入探讨AI在空间探索中的应用,以及它如何改变我们的宇宙之旅。
一、AI在航天任务中的角色
1. 自动化操作
在航天任务中,AI可以自动执行各种操作,如卫星的部署、调整轨道、对接等。这使得航天器能够更加高效、安全地完成任务。以下是一个简单的示例代码,展示了如何使用Python编写一个模拟卫星轨道调整的AI程序:
import numpy as np
class Satellite:
def __init__(self, position, velocity):
self.position = position
self.velocity = velocity
def update_position(self, acceleration, time_step):
self.velocity += acceleration * time_step
self.position += self.velocity * time_step
def simulate_satellite(satellite, acceleration, time_step, duration):
for _ in range(int(duration / time_step)):
satellite.update_position(acceleration, time_step)
# 创建卫星实例,设置初始位置和速度
satellite = Satellite(np.array([0, 0]), np.array([1000, 0]))
# 模拟卫星运动
simulate_satellite(satellite, np.array([0, -9.8]), 0.1, 60)
print("Final position:", satellite.position)
2. 数据分析
AI在航天任务中的另一个关键应用是数据分析。通过分析大量的航天数据,AI可以帮助研究人员发现新的规律,优化航天器设计和任务规划。以下是一个使用Python进行数据分析的示例:
import pandas as pd
# 加载数据
data = pd.read_csv("spacecraft_data.csv")
# 绘制散点图
data.plot(x="altitude", y="power_consumption")
3. 智能决策
在航天任务中,AI还可以帮助进行智能决策。例如,在遇到紧急情况时,AI可以迅速分析各种可能性,并提出最优解决方案。以下是一个使用Python进行智能决策的示例:
def smart_decision(current_state, possible_actions):
# 根据当前状态和可能的行动,选择最佳行动
# 这里只是一个简单的示例,实际应用中需要更复杂的算法
best_action = np.argmax([action效益 for action in possible_actions])
return possible_actions[best_action]
# 假设有一个当前状态和可能的行动列表
current_state = {"altitude": 300, "velocity": 250}
possible_actions = [{"thrust": 100}, {"thrust": 200}, {"thrust": 300}]
# 执行智能决策
best_action = smart_decision(current_state, possible_actions)
print("Best action:", best_action)
二、AI革命带来的变化
1. 提高航天任务成功率
AI的应用使得航天任务更加智能化、自动化,从而提高了任务成功率。例如,在火星探测任务中,AI可以帮助探测器自主识别地形、规划路线,避免碰撞等风险。
2. 降低成本
AI的应用还可以降低航天任务的成本。通过自动化操作和智能决策,航天器可以更加高效地完成任务,减少人力和物力投入。
3. 促进科技创新
AI技术在航天领域的应用,推动了相关领域的科技创新。例如,为了满足AI在航天任务中的需求,研究人员不断开发新的传感器、算法和材料。
三、未来展望
随着AI技术的不断发展,未来空间探索中的AI革命将更加深入。以下是几个未来展望:
1. 航天器自主飞行
未来,航天器将实现更加自主的飞行。AI将帮助航天器在复杂环境中自主导航、避障,甚至进行自我修复。
2. 跨星际旅行
AI技术将助力人类实现跨星际旅行。通过优化航天器设计、提高能源利用效率,AI将使人类探索更远的宇宙成为可能。
3. 航天器生命支持系统
AI技术将应用于航天器生命支持系统,为宇航员提供更加舒适、安全的生存环境。
总之,AI革命正在深刻改变空间探索领域,为人类宇宙之旅带来无限可能。随着AI技术的不断进步,我们有理由相信,未来人类将探索更广阔的宇宙。
